What addiction treatment options are available in Alamo, ND, given its rural location?

Due to Alamo's small, rural setting, local treatment options are limited, but residents typically access care through nearby facilities in larger cities like Minot or Williston, which are within driving distance. Many Alamo residents utilize outpatient programs, telehealth services, or travel to residential centers in these areas, often with support from local resources like the Mountrail County Health Department for referrals and transportation assistance.

How can someone in Alamo, ND, find and verify a reputable rehab center in the region?

Start by contacting the Mountrail County Human Service Zone or the North Dakota Department of Human Services for state-licensed facilities near Alamo, such as those in Minot or Bismarck. Additionally, use online tools like the Substance Abuse and Mental Health Services Administration (SAMHSA) Treatment Locator, filtering for North Dakota, and read reviews or seek referrals from local healthcare providers at the Alamo Clinic for trusted recommendations.

Are there any local support groups or aftercare resources in Alamo, ND, for ongoing recovery?

Alamo itself has limited in-person support groups, but nearby communities like New Town or Stanley may host NA or AA meetings, which can be accessed with planning. For ongoing support, residents often rely on virtual meetings through organizations like SMART Recovery or AA Online, and the Mountrail County Health Department can connect individuals with case management and follow-up care to maintain recovery in a rural setting.

What should I expect regarding insurance coverage and costs for addiction treatment as an Alamo, ND resident?

Most rehab centers in North Dakota accept major insurance plans, including Medicaid (through ND Medicaid), Medicare, and private insurers, but it's crucial to verify coverage with facilities in cities like Minot before committing. For uninsured residents, options include sliding-scale fees at community health centers or applying for state-funded programs through the North Dakota Department of Human Services, with local assistance available from the Mountrail County Social Services office.

How can families in Alamo, ND, support a loved one entering addiction treatment, especially with travel involved?

Families can coordinate with treatment centers in nearby cities to arrange family therapy sessions, often available via telehealth to reduce travel. Utilize local resources like the Mountrail County Health Department for counseling referrals and education on addiction, and consider forming a support network with neighbors or community groups in Alamo to help with logistics, such as transportation or childcare, during the treatment process.

North Dakota has developed a robust system to address substance use disorders, recognizing the specific challenges faced by its residents. For someone in Alamo, practical recovery resources often involve a combination of local support and regional treatment centers. A vital first call is to the North Dakota Department of Human Services Behavioral Health Division. They operate a free, confidential helpline that can connect you to state-approved assessments, treatment providers, and funding options, all based on your location. This service is invaluable for navigating the system and understanding what is covered by insurance or state programs. Furthermore, while Alamo itself may not have a residential treatment facility, several reputable centers are within a manageable distance in cities like Williston, Minot, or even across the state line in Montana. These facilities offer various levels of care, from medical detox and inpatient programs to intensive outpatient services, which allow you to receive treatment while maintaining some daily routines.
